Default Maps not showing up in Generals

I extracted the map HOMELAND ALLIANCE from the Map Big file,added 5 buildings to it,and saved it under the same name.

When i start the game and select the user maps,its not there in the map list.

I also took the same map and resized it to 500x500,made 2 versions of it named FULL URBAN CONFLICT and FULL URBAN CONFLICT 2,saved them in the same map folder and the same thing happens,they don't show up in the list.

The path to the maps are correct.

C:\Documents and Settings\adamstrange\My Documents\Command and Conquer Generals Data\Maps

I opened another map thats in this folder called CITY SIEGE and removed 2 buildings and when i started the game this map did show up in the list and in the game with the 2 missing buildings.


So far i have noticed the HOMELAND ALLIANCE is a map that comes with the game and no matter what i do to it,even renaming it to STRIKE FIELD,it still did not show up.

I also inserted STRIKE FIELD into the MAP BIG file and after saving it,it does not show up in the official system maps either.

Is there something different in the official maps that once they are removed from the MAP BIG file and edited,they will not show up in either the user maps or the official maps even though you save it in WB to the right folder?

Anyone know why this is happening

For user maps you have to put it in a folder under the map name eg:
Maps\HOMELAND ALLIANCE
and put the map files in there as for official maps you go to the Generals/ZH folder you installed it in create a maps folder if you have not already and then the foldername you saw on XCC Mixer if you use it eg for the shell map it would be (by defult):
C:\Program Files\EA Games\Command and Conquer \Maps\ShellMap1\
